At present,automated production line technology has been widely used in the field of industrial production,which is of great significance to improve the level of intelligence and production efficiency,as well as to improve product quality and reduce energy consumption,so it has higher application value.However,automation is the requirement of equipment monitoring and management maintenance under production mode,and also the improvement of the model.Maintenance and management personnel need to be familiar with it.In this paper,considering the requirement of training high-quality front-line operation technicians,the demand analysis is carried out,and an automatic production system based on Mitsubishi PLC is designed.The main components of this system include feeding,assembly,processing,sorting and so on.A PLC is set up to control the system.The programmable controller chooses Mitsubishi FX series.When the on-line system communicates with each other,the master and slave stations communicate with each other through RS485 serial communication,and on this basis,distributed control is carried out.The master and slave stations are configured on the spot through touch screen.In the process of platform design,it is carried out in accordance with the actual automation production line of enterprises,and ensures that all functions remain unchanged,reduces the size of mechanical components,and meets the requirements of teaching application.This system has high application value for practical teaching in Higher Vocational schools,and also can provide support for staff training.In the process of electric development of this platform,the electric development scheme is designed according to the application requirements.The overall composition of the platform and the corresponding working process are equipped,and then the appropriate controller and communication mode are selected.Then the pneumatic system and electrical control are designed.On this basis,the PLC program is compiled,and the configuration is carried out,and the test is carried out.
